Transaction c75248126e71d49be02d80f28170e32f85b7a26ca6643daa6b91ea58eb1493cf

1 Input
2 Outputs
  • c75248126e71d49be02d80f28170e32f85b7a26ca6643daa6b91ea58eb1493cf:0
  • value  12672251
    address  3FudC8D5TdyVyizefFtXufLS6TirZEWpbq
  • c75248126e71d49be02d80f28170e32f85b7a26ca6643daa6b91ea58eb1493cf:1
  • value  127743879
    address  bc1qek33a7j78cfks9py4qtuadkjetnj7wjr29r70slggnmcplnpyncqy8ztyl